APPLICATION FOR A NEW PREMISES LICENCE
Take notice that we Tesco Stores Limited have made an application to Reigate and Banstead Borough Council acting as the Licensing Authority, for a New Premises Licence in respect of Tesco Express, 122 London Road, Redhill, Surrey, RH1 2JJ.
For the provision of late-night refreshment (indoors) on the following days: Monday-Sunday, 23:00-00:00. And the sale by retail of alcohol for consumption off the premises on the following days: Monday-Sunday, 06:00- 00:00.
The application and the Licensing Authority’s public register can be inspected at: The Town Hall, Castlefield Road, Reigate RH2 0SH, Monday to Friday (except on public holidays) between the hours of 10.00 am to 4.00 pm.
The date by which relevant persons may make representations to the relevant Licensing Authority against this application is: 23/07/2026.
Take note that it is an offence knowingly or recklessly to make a false statement in connection with an application and the maximum fine for which a person is liable on summary conviction is Level 5 on the standard scale of fines (£5,000).
